Benefits of Urban Trees

Trees Increase Economic Stability

[Photograph]: Trees in an open space around an office building.

The scope and condition of a community’s trees and, collectively, its urban forest, is usually the first impression a community projects to its visitors. Studies have shown that:

  • Trees enhance community economic stability by attracting businesses and tourists.
  • People linger and shop longer along tree-lined streets.
  • Apartments and offices in wooded areas rent more quickly, have higher occupancy rates and tenants stay longer.
  • Businesses leasing office space in wooded developments find their workers are more productive and absenteeism is reduced.

A community’s urban forest is an extension of its pride and community spirit.
